Zattoo gets competitor

A new online platform has launched in Switzerland, offering live streams of conventional TV channels via the internet.

Dubbed Wilmaa, the service, which is backed by Zurich-based IP video service provider Solutionpark Streaming, currently comprises 22 channels including Switzerland’s main public and commercial broadcasters, as well as thematic channels and foreign services.

The live-streams are accessible for free at www.wilmaa.com after a one-time registration. As is the case with competitor Zattoo, which offers a comparable internet TV streaming service, Wilmaa aims to finance through commercials which are shown when the service is first accessed and during channel switching.

However, in contrast to Zattoo no software player needs to be downloaded and installed on the computer to access the live-streams. Instead, the service uses the conventional internet browser.

Both Wilmaa and Zattoo offer comparable picture quality. While Wilmaa is currently only available to internet users in Switzerland, Zattoo offers its service in several European countries including the UK.
